In this paper, we present an automated small-sized device designed to determine the blood type. That device can be used in emergency situations or in small medical laboratories. In the proposed device, determination of the blood type will be carried out using reagents of monoclonal antibodies, called zoliclones. The principle of operation is based on the use of the method of photometry of drop samples. This method allows assessing the degree of specific agglutination of erythrocytes. In accordance with this method, the detection of agglutination occurs by photometry of test samples formed in the form of lying drops. In the presence of erythrocyte agglutination, changes in the intensity of the light flux passing through the sample are recorded. To accelerate erythrocyte agglutination, the sample in our device will be vibrated by vibration platform. The paper presents a block diagram, a layout of the device and the results of experimental studies
